在Python中创建新的空白zip文件的方法
发布时间:2023-12-17 04:20:16
在Python中,可以使用zipfile模块来创建新的空白ZIP文件。下面是具体的步骤和一个使用例子。
步骤1:导入zipfile模块。
import zipfile
步骤2:使用zipfile.ZipFile()函数创建一个新的ZIP文件对象。可以指定文件名和打开模式(默认为读取模式)。
zip_file = zipfile.ZipFile('new_file.zip', 'w')
步骤3:关闭ZIP文件对象。
zip_file.close()
使用例子:创建一个包含空白TXT文件的ZIP文件。
import zipfile
# 创建一个新的ZIP文件对象
zip_file = zipfile.ZipFile('new_file.zip', 'w')
# 创建一个空白TXT文件
file_name = 'blank.txt'
with open(file_name, 'w') as file:
pass
# 将空白TXT文件添加到ZIP文件中
zip_file.write(file_name)
# 关闭ZIP文件对象
zip_file.close()
在上面的例子中,我们首先创建了一个新的ZIP文件对象zip_file,指定文件名为new_file.zip,打开模式为写入模式。然后,我们创建了一个空白的TXT文件blank.txt,并将其添加到ZIP文件中。最后,我们关闭了ZIP文件对象。
这样,我们就成功地创建了一个新的空白ZIP文件,并将空白TXT文件添加到其中。你可以根据需要修改文件名和文件内容,以满足具体的应用场景。
